Output 99b71250a2c375efe8c628702aa19fcd85efebdaaa00a03f452a43c49a3dd429:0

value
128658
script pubkey
OP_0 OP_PUSHBYTES_32 72e31752abf584a407379df0cd00dec96ec1bfad83addcb4c7ee79c2063850c0
address
bc1qwt33w54t7kz2gpehnhcv6qx7e9hvr0adswkaedx8aeuuyp3c2rqqlmdq5f
transaction
99b71250a2c375efe8c628702aa19fcd85efebdaaa00a03f452a43c49a3dd429
confirmations
343461
spent
true